QGIS parses shapefiles with or without a CPG file to UTF-8 by default.
You can override this manually, but this often leads to trouble because staff is not always aware of this problem.
I've often seen statt loading ISO-8859-1 coded DBFs in QGIS. QGIS parses it as UTF-8 and when edits are done, things get messed up.
This results in ISO-8859-1 (loaded as UTF-8) and UTF-8 mixed entries, which get saved as UTF-8.
Is it possible to add some kind of dialog with asks for the charset, if no CPG file is available? Perhaps with a small preview window of characters making trouble. A dialog windows, like it's used for SRS/CRS ... even Microsoft Excel has such a dialog window :)
